Description
Accounts for 1478. Money paid by the Procurator to the rector/warden of St Thomas'. The following information is taken from the paper catalogue: 'Accounts of expenditure of money received from William Whitm[arsh], procurator of the Dean and Chapter in the church of St. Thomas the Martyr in the city of Salisbury, appropriated to the maintenance of the fabric, "and delivered by the said Sir William Whitm[arsh] into the hands of Master William Nessyngwik, rector or warden of the same church", 3 May 1478. This is in book-form, and the accounts are set out rather differently from in the rolls, but apart from that, they follow more or less the same lines, and therefore this document has been put here...' The accounts appear to run from May to October. Nessyngwik was one of the residentiary canons (according to paper catalogue).
